A few decades ago, Cuba cut off all interaction with the U.S. Although this happened, Cuban citizens are familiar with U.S. brands. As President Obama tries to better public affairs with Cuba, U.S. commercial businesses will be going into uncharted territory. Many businesses believe that they will not be successful in Cuba because for decades billboards and advertising platforms have been promoting politics rather than commercial businesses like the U.S. does.
